Frequently Asked Questions
What specific local issues in Royston, GA, should I discuss with a real estate attorney before buying a property?
In Royston and Franklin County, it's crucial to discuss zoning for agricultural or residential use, verify there are no unrecorded easements common in rural areas, and ensure proper septic system permits and well water rights are in order, as these are frequent local concerns.
How can a Royston real estate attorney help with a family land inheritance or boundary dispute?
A local attorney can help navigate Georgia's probate laws to clear title on inherited land, which is common in the area. They can also order a precise survey to resolve boundary disputes with neighboring farms or properties, often using their knowledge of local land records and history.
Are there unique closing cost considerations when using a real estate attorney in Royston versus a title company?
Yes. In Georgia, attorneys often handle closings directly. In Royston, your attorney's fee may be bundled with title search and insurance costs. They can also identify and explain any local county or municipal fees, ensuring all transfer taxes are correctly calculated for Franklin County.
What should I look for when choosing a real estate attorney in Royston, GA?
Look for an attorney with extensive experience in Franklin County real estate transactions. They should have strong relationships with the local Clerk of Court's office for efficient recording and specific knowledge of issues like rural land use covenants, agricultural exemptions, and well and septic regulations in the area.
Can a Royston attorney assist with drafting a contract for the sale of raw land or a farm?
Absolutely. A local real estate attorney is essential for drafting contracts for raw land or agricultural property. They can include critical provisions specific to Georgia law and Royston, such as soil percolation test contingencies, timber rights, mineral rights disclosures, and access guarantees via unpaved roads.
